My direct ancestor is William Olive This John Olive's Brother b 1754 November. William came to the Colonies as a

Shipwright in 1773 and Married in New York. At the end of the Revolution he went to what now is New Brunswick, Canada. He had a large family. His Great Grandson Herbert James Olive came to Washington in 1902 and settled in (Mission) Cashmere Washington.
